发明名称 PROTECTION CONTROL METHOD FOR WELDING POWER SOURCE
摘要 PROBLEM TO BE SOLVED: To restrain a fall in production efficiency due to the interruption of welding caused by the operation of protection control for a usage rate of a welding power source.SOLUTION: A protection control method for a welding power source includes computing the average value Si of a square of a welding current every moment for the past 10 minutes, and intercepting the energization of the welding current based on the average value Si. In this protection control method, when the average value Si reaches a usage rate reference value St, a temperature detection value Hd of a temperature sensor provided in a welding power source when continuing welding to the end, is estimated, and a temperature estimated value Hs is compared with a temperature reference value Ht. In the case of Hs<Ht, welding is continued to the end, and in the case of Hs&ge;Ht, the energization of the welding current Iw is intercepted to stop welding. Consequently, since welding is continued when temperature detection value Hd of the temperature sensor is assumed to be less than the temperature reference value Ht that does not have an adverse effect on the welding power source even if welding is continued to the end, a fall in production efficiency can be restrained.
